Abstract
Phytochemical investigation of the methanolic extract of the aerial parts of Artemisia absinthium Linn. (Asteraceae) yielded four new phytoconstituents characterized as stigmast-5,22-dien-3β-ol-21-oic acid-3β-glucopyranosyl-2'- octadec-9''-enoate (1); lanost-24-en-3β-ol-11-one-28-oic acid-21,23 α-olide-3β-D-glucopyranosyl-2'-dihydrocaffeoate-6'- decanoate (2); tricosan-14-on-1,4-olide-5-eicos-9'-enoate (3) and 3,11-dimethyldodecan-1,7-dioic acid-1-β-D-glucopyranosyl-6'- octadec-9''-enoate (4). The structures of these phytoconstituents have been elucidated on the basis of spectral data analysis and chemical reactions.
